What is an Accident Lawyer?
An accident lawyer, also called a personal injury attorney, focuses on representing clients who have actually suffered injuries as an outcome of accidents triggered by the negligence or misbehavior of others. Their main objective is to ensure that victims get the compensation they are worthy of for their losses, which may include medical expenses, lost incomes, discomfort and suffering, and more.

Just how much does it cost to hire an accident lawyer?
Many accident attorneys work on a contingency charge basis, suggesting they only make money if you win your case. Their charges generally vary from 25% to 40% of the overall settlement or award.
2. How long do I have to sue?
The statute of limitations differs by state and kind of accident, but it typically varies from one to three years from the date of the Accident Injury Attorney.
3.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?
Many states follow a relative neglect guideline, meaning your compensation might be decreased based on your percentage of fault. An accident lawyer can assist you browse these intricacies.
4. Will my case go to trial?
The majority of accident cases are settled out of court. However, if a reasonable settlement can not be reached, your lawyer might suggest taking your case to trial.
